Default Stock header pipe for Wide Glide

I want to replace my Stock head pipe with a Cat Less head pipe. I have a 2014 FXDWG.
Is it just the 2008 & 2009 Fat Bob that came stock with no Cat in the head pipe??? Any advice is greatly appreciated.

Different size O2 sensors in the 2008-2009 Fat Bob headers. .18mm vs 12mm. .you'd have to get adapters, which are available, but then your O2 sensors would not go deep enough into the pipe to collect good readings. Your best option is to do as Joe suggested in terms of cost and function. The heat shields will cover the weld.
